¿Qué significa llave USB?
El protector de software USB inalámbrico (dongle) es un pequeño complemento que se puede conectar al puerto paralelo, al puerto serie o al USB de la computadora.
El dongle a menudo se considera una protección de hardware. Un pequeño complemento que se puede conectar al puerto paralelo, al puerto serie o al USB de una computadora y que contiene una EPROM activada de fábrica y un circuito integrado personalizado para aplicaciones específicas. El principio de protección del dongle es que los desarrolladores de software a menudo verifican las celdas del dongle en el programa y comparan los valores de retorno. Esta verificación puede realizarse leyendo directamente las celdas o usando algún algoritmo interno (en este momento, las celdas están protegidas y no pueden). ser leído directamente). Aunque cualquier ingeniero de hardware competente puede analizar fácilmente cómo se implementa el dongle, en realidad no es tan problemático. El eslabón más débil de la protección del dongle es que la aplicación debe acceder al dongle a través de la biblioteca de funciones proporcionada por el fabricante del dongle y la aplicación. La relación entre el programa y estas funciones suele ser muy débil, porque a los desarrolladores de software no les importa cómo acceden estas funciones al dongle. Solo verifica si el valor de retorno de la función indica éxito o fracaso. Luego simplemente parchea para que todas las funciones devuelvan éxito. , y estas Por lo general, no hay muchas funciones, y las definiciones de estas funciones (parámetros y valores de retorno) se pueden encontrar fácilmente en el manual API proporcionado por el fabricante. En términos generales, el descifrado del dongle no requiere el perro original.
En términos de computadoras, dongle = llave de hardware, en China se le conoce comúnmente como "perro". Se utiliza para prevenir el robo de software, al igual que un perro guardián, como se le llama. El apodo chino parece llamarse "clave de derechos de autor", pero se desconoce si esto es cierto. También puedes considerar "bloquear al perro" para recopilar el significado del sonido.
En las redes de ordenadores, un dongle es un cable de red corto que conecta un adaptador PCMCIA a un cable de red. Por lo general, un dongle pertenece a cada conector RJ-45 en una red Ethernet o a un conector RJ-11 en una red de acceso telefónico. Los dongles tienden a medir no más de 6 pulgadas. El término "dongle" también se ha vuelto popular en las redes USB para referirse a la extensión de un cable USB desde un dispositivo periférico USB.